SBS is a severe form of child abuse caused by the violent shak- ing of an infant or child *2+. When signifi- cant rotational acceleration-deceleration forces are applied, the brain is susceptible to shearing of the bridging veins in the subdural space, diffuse axonal injury, contusion and oedema. Shaking an infant or small child can cause bleeding into the back of the eyes *3+.and other injuries such as damage to the neck, spine, and eyes *4+. It is dangerous and can cause severe brain damage, blindness, cerebral palsy, mental retardation, behavioural disorders, and impaired motor and cogni- tive skills. Factors that may increase the risk of inflicting shaken baby syndrome Background and objectives: Shaken baby syndrome and pediatric abuse head trauma are the most common causes of mortality and morbidity due to physical child abuse. Nurses have a main role in parents’ education regarding child abuse prevention. This study aimed to assess nurses’ knowledge regarding shaken baby syndrome in Erbil City. Methods: A descriptive study was conducted at postpartum units, the delivery room and the ward at the Maternity Teaching Hospital, and the inpatient and intensive care units at Rapareen Pediatric Teaching Hospital in 2017 in Erbil City. A purposive sample of 50 nurses was recruited to the study. The data collection was performed using a questionnaire for interviewing the study participants, and the data were analyzed using descriptive and in- ferential statistical analysis. Results: The study findings revealed that the majority of the study participants were 19-25 years old and most did not have enough knowledge regarding the signs and symptoms of the shaken baby syndrome (irritability, lethargy, poor feeding breathing problems, uncon- trollable crying, vomiting, bluish skin, changes in sleeping pattern, convulsions or seizures and unresponsiveness). Nurses also had insufficient knowledge about the risk factors of this condition. Only a quarter of nurses knew that domestic violence is a risk factor and less than a quarter of them recognized depression and substance abuse of the caregiver as a risk factor. Regarding knowledge of the complications, the study found that a quarter of nurses knew that brain damage, cerebral palsy and blindness are complications of the shaken baby syndrome. Conclusions: Majority of nurses had poor knowledge about causes, signs, symptoms, risk factors and complications of the shaken baby syndrome. Keywords: Shaken Baby Syndrome; Nurse; Knowledge. SBS leads to extreme irritability, lethargy, poor feeding, breathing problems, convulsions, vomiting, and pale or bluish skin. Shaken baby injuries usually occur in children younger than 2 years old, but maybe seen in children up to the age of 5 *6+. The data indicate that 1,000 to 1,500 infants per year are shaken and sustain a head injury. According to the information from the Cen- ter for Disease Control and Prevention in the United States, of the nearly 2,000 chil- dren who die from abuse every year, pedi- atric abusive head trauma, or SBS is re- sponsible for 10-12 percent of those fatali- ties. Research also indicates that there is a strong relationship between poverty and child abuse *2+. Nearly all victims of SBS have serious health consequences, such as brain injury, cerebral palsy, seizures and paralysis, and at least one of every four ba- bies who are violently shaken dies. Most adults who admit to shaking a baby say that they became frustrated and upset when the baby would not stop crying *7+. Child Welfare Information *8+ suggests solving this problem by teaching parents and nurses about the dangers of shaking a baby, as well as ways to cope with the stresses of caring for a child. These educa- tional programmes are very effective in re- ducing the incidence of SBS. A systematic review conducted in New York State rec- ommends that all hospitals should offer new parents the option of viewing a video on SBS, including ways to cope with a cry- ing child. Furthermore, it is reported that in developing countries, SBS is one of the leading causes of death *9+. Currently, there are no statistical data about SBS in Iraq and Erbil City, and no published stud- ies about nurses’ knowledge of SBS, which is one of the reasons for conducting this study. The descriptive study design was used to assess nurses’ knowledge about shaken baby syndrome. This study was carried out from November 2016 to November 2017 at two public hospitals in Erbil City. These hospitals included Maternity and Rapareen Pediatric Teaching Hospitals. Official per- mission to conduct the study was obtained from the Erbil General Directorate of Health and the involved hospitals. A pur- posive research sample consisted of 50 nurses from postpartum units, the delivery room and the ward at the Maternity Teaching Hospital, and the inpatient and intensive care units at Rapareen Pediatric Teaching Hospital in Erbil City. Nurses’ oral informed consent was obtained for partici- pation in the study, after confirmation of confidentiality, anonymity, and partici- pants’ self-determination by the research- er. The researcher constructed a question- naire after an extensive review of relevant literature. The questionnaire included three parts. The first part contained socio- demographic information of nurses (age, gender, level of education, hospital setting, duration of experience in nursing and the current unit, participation in training courses and seminars). The second part assessed nurses’ knowledge regarding shaken baby syndrome and was divided into five domains (definition, carrying baby criteria, signs and symptoms, risk factors, complications). The third part was de- signed to assess the source of nurses’ knowledge about SBS (nursing school, TV, internet, journals, physicians, seminar, workshop and conference). The knowledge of SBS items was rated and scored accord- ing to the two points type scale for all items and scored as 2 and 1 for correct, incorrect answer respectively. Concerning nurses’ knowledge about crying baby criteria, the current study shows that majority of nurses replied in- correctly to most of crying baby criteria items, with highest percentages only in two items (infant cries is not always a sign that something is wrong, and shaking baby is not a good way to help a baby stop cry- ing), confirming that nurses have knowledge deficit in this regard. Bravo states that every infant who is discharged from a newborn nursery should be sent home with parents who are prepared for neonatal care. Through educational pro- grams, parents can receive positive guide- lines to help them to cope with children who have special needs, need extra atten- tion, or simply cry for long periods *11+, and nurses are responsible for educating of mothers before discharge. Adding to that, SBS often occurs after shaking in re- sponse to crying attacks *12+. This impli- cates the importance of nurses’ knowledge about crying baby. Regarding nurses knowledge about signs and symp- toms of SBS, the finding of the present study reveals that majority of nurses did not know the signs and symptoms of SBS and gave incorrect answers to the ques- tionnaire items (irritable, lethargy, poor feeding, breathing problems, uncontrolla- ble crying, vomiting, bluish skin, changes in sleeping patterns, convulsions or sei- zures and unresponsive). This finding re- veals nurses’ poor information about SBS symptoms when it is expected from the nurses to discover abused and maltreated children in addition to their responsibility in educating parents about SBS prevention and child safety. Regarding nurses’ knowledge about risk factors of SBS, the current study found that about a quarter of nurses know that domestic violence is a risk factor for SBS. This is compatible with the study done in the United States by Steven et al, which mentions that care- takers at risk of abusive behaviour gener- ally have unrealistic expectations of their children and may exhibit a role reversal whereby caretakers expect their needs to be met by the child *13-14+. In the cur- rent study, less than a quarter of nurses recognized that depression and sub- stance abuse of caregiver is a risk factor for SBS of children. This is in agreement with a study, which shows that the most common risk factor for perpetrators, most frequently parents, is the inability to cope with stress, substance abuse, in- fants born to mothers who suffer from depression or consume alcohol during pregnancy *15+. Regarding nurses’ knowledge about complications of SBS, the current study found that about a quarter of nurses know that brain dam- age, cerebral palsy and blindness are complications of SBS. This result is sup- ported by Walls and Castiglia who men- tion that the main complications of SBS involve impaired mental, physical, and sensory development, visual impair- ments, blindness, seizure disorder, devel- opmental delays, motor dysfunction, spasticity, cerebral palsy *16+.
